Autor Thema: LyricExtender länger  (Gelesen 1669 mal)

Radler

  • Member
LyricExtender länger
« am: Freitag, 27. Juli 2012, 17:16 »
Hallo liebe Lilypondianer,

Lilypond setzt den LyricExtender längstens bis zur letzten Note, für die die Silbe gelten soll. Das ist bei mehrstimmigen Noten mitunter nicht wunschgemäß, weil die Linienlänge die Dauer symbolisieren soll - in allen Stimmen gleich lang.

Weiß jemand, wie ich Lilypond dazu bringen kann, den Strich nach "Ja" in der zweiten Stimme (eine Note) genau so lang zu machen, wie in der ersten Stimme (4 Noten mit Bindebogen)?

Anbei der Code und das erzeugte PDF.

Viele Grüße und vielen Dank
von Radler

\version "2.15.41"
\score
{
<<
\new Staff
{
\new Voice = "sopran"
{
c''4( e'' c'' e'')
}
}
\new Lyrics \lyricsto "sopran"
{
Ja __
}
\new Staff
{
\new Voice = "alt"
{
c''1
}
}
\new Lyrics \lyricsto "alt"
{
Ja __
}
>>
}

harm6

  • Member
Re: LyricExtender länger
« Antwort #1 am: Freitag, 27. Juli 2012, 17:59 »
Hallo Radler,

entweder mit
\override LyricExtender #'minimum-length = #10(muß man dann natürlich manuell einstellen)

oder die Ganze Note in ihrer (internen) Dauer verkürzen und eine unsichtbare weitere einfügen. Für diese muß dann im Text ein weiterer Unterstrich enutzt werden.
\version "2.15.39"
\score
{
<<
\new Staff
{
\new Voice = "sopran"
{
c''4( e'' c'' e'')
}
}
\new Lyrics \lyricsto "sopran"
{
Ja __
}
\new Staff
{
\new Voice = "alt"
{
c''1*3/4  \once \hideNotes c''4
}
}
\new Lyrics \lyricsto "alt"
{
Ja __ _
}
>>
}


HTH,
  Harm

Radler

  • Member
Re: LyricExtender länger
« Antwort #2 am: Freitag, 27. Juli 2012, 21:20 »
Ey, das ist ja geil!!!
c''1*3/4 kannte ich bisher nicht. Unter welchem Stichwort finde ich dazu etwas in notation.pdf?
Vielen Dank Harm!
Grüße
von Radler

harm6

  • Member
Re: LyricExtender länger
« Antwort #3 am: Freitag, 27. Juli 2012, 21:57 »
Zitat
c''1*3/4 kannte ich bisher nicht. Unter welchem Stichwort finde ich dazu etwas in notation.pdf?

NR 1.2.1 Rhythmen eingeben
Tondauern skalieren
-> link (zur engl. NR)

Gruß,
  Harm

Radler

  • Member
Re: LyricExtender länger
« Antwort #4 am: Freitag, 27. Juli 2012, 23:58 »
Nochmals Dank, lieber Harm!

Es ist leider eine ziemliche Fummelei mit der *-Schreibweise; und an allen Stellen einzugeben.

Irgendwie ist in meine Erinnerung gekommen, man könne Lilypond sagen, sie LyricExtender sollen so lang sein, wie die Note dauert. Hat sonst noch jemand eine solche Ahnung?

Viele Grüße
von Radler